Galal Yafai vs Francisco Rodriguez Jr: Date, time, records, where to watch and everything about the fight

This weekend, international boxing focuses its attention on Birmingham, England, where the undefeated Galal Yafai takes on Mexican veteran Francisco “Chihuas” Rodriguez Jr. in a bout that promises to be as technical as it is exciting. Although it is not a unification of world titles, the World Boxing Council (WBC) interim belt will be at stake, which makes this fight a direct prelude to a future fight for the absolute championship against Kenshiro Teraji.

Both fighters have clear objectives. Yafai, after winning gold at the Tokyo Olympics and building an impeccable professional start, is looking to consolidate his position among the best in the flyweight division. Rodriguez Jr., on the other hand, brings the experience of 46 fights, a past as a world champion and the motivation to prove that he can still compete at the highest level.

Fighter records and history

Galal Yafai (9-0, 7 KO) is considered one of the great promises of British boxing. Since his transition from amateur to professional, he has shown constant evolution and respectable punching power. His most recent victory was a resounding knockout against Sunny Edwards, who decided to retire after the defeat. At 32 years of age, Yafai fights as a southpaw and combines speed, pressure and technique in each performance.

Francisco Rodriguez Jr. (39-6-1, 27 KOs) arrives with an extensive professional career, having faced boxing legends such as Roman “Chocolatito” Gonzalez, Donnie Nietes, Junto Nakatani and Kazuto Ioka. Also 32 years old, the Mexican is characterized by his resilience, international experience and aggressive orthodox style. His track record backs him up as a serious opponent for any elite contender.

Galal Yafai vs Francisco Rodriguez Jr fight date:

The fight between Galal Yafai and Francisco Rodriguez Jr. will take place on Saturday, June 21, 2025, at BP Pulse LIVE (formerly Resorts World Arena) in Birmingham, United Kingdom. For fans in the United States, the main card will begin at 2:00 PM ET / 11:00 AM PT, while the main event is scheduled to start around 5:00 PM ET / 2:00 PM PT.

Where to watch the fight: Galal Yafai vs Francisco Rodriguez Jr:

The entire evening will be broadcast live on DAZN, at no additional cost to subscribers. The platform will offer full coverage of the card from 2:00 PM ET, with the advantage that it will be available in more than 200 countries. No pay-per-view (PPV) is required, only an active DAZN subscription.

With an interim title on the line and a future world championship fight on the horizon, the clash between Galal Yafai and Francisco Rodriguez Jr. promises to be one of the most important of the year in the flyweight division.
